Affordability of Living in Flossmoor, IL

The median home value is $327,346
MonthMedian home value
April 2025$316k
May 2025$316k
June 2025$316k
July 2025$318k
August 2025$320k
September 2025$322k
October 2025$323k
November 2025$323k
December 2025$324k
January 2026$325k
February 2026$326k
March 2026$327k

Average Home Value in Flossmoor, IL, by Home Size

Currently, there are 5 new listings in Flossmoor, IL and 37 homes for sale.
Home SizeHome Value*
2 bedrooms (2 homes)$206,854
3 bedrooms (7 homes)$279,692
4 bedrooms (11 homes)$366,458
*Home value over the past month
